Job summary
A higher education institution is seeking Part-Time Faculty & Lab Instructors for its Electrical Engineering Technology program in St. Petersburg, FL. Instructors will facilitate online courses and in-person lab sessions, guiding students through practical exercises in electrical engineering. Candidates should have a Master's degree and experience in engineering. The position offers a competitive compensation of $1,000 per credit hour per course.
Qualifications
Master’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Electronics Engineering Technology, or closely related field.
2+ years of professional experience in electrical/electronics engineering or related roles.
Familiarity with standard lab equipment and safety protocols.
Responsibilities
Facilitate in-person and hybrid lab sessions aligned with course outcomes.
Guide students through practical exercises.
Provide timely, constructive feedback on lab performance.
Collaborate with faculty, site staff, and lab technicians.
